Toronto Raptors Secure Fourth Year of Scottie Barnes’ Rookie Contract

As expected, the Raptors have exercised their team option to secure the fourth year of Scottie Barnes’ rookie contract, who is thus tied to the Canadian organization until the end of the 2024-25 season.

By guaranteeing the 10.1 million dollars stipulated in the rookie agreement for the aforementioned campaign, the former number 4 in the 2021 draft will be eligible to sign a rookie scale extension in the summer of 2024.

The forward trained at Florida State University was named Rookie of the Year in 2022, but in his second season in the NBA he could not take the step forward that many expected. He averaged 15.3 points, but shot 28 percent from 3-point range and grabbed 6.6 rebounds per night, fewer than his rookie year. In any case, Toronto remains blindly confident in his potential.

Thinking about the present, and although he admits that losing Fred VanVleet is not good news, Barnes believes that it also has its positive side, since it will allow other boys to develop and have more weight on the hardwood – including him – .
